メインコンテンツまでスキップ
バージョン: 1.0.4

CpuLimitationLevelStatus

パッケージ


com.nttqonoq.devices.android.mirzalibrary.data

Enum Class CpuLimitationLevelStatus

継承ツリー


Object
 Enum<CpuLimitationLevelStatus>
  com.nttqonoq.devices.android.mirzalibrary.data.CpuLimitationLevelStatus

クラスの説明


public enum CpuLimitationLevelStatus
extends Enum<CpuLimitationLevelStatus>

グラスのCPU制限レベル状態を表すEnum

ネストされたクラスの概要


クラスから継承されたネストされたクラス/インターフェース
Enum.EnumDesc<E extends Enum<E>>

列挙型定数の概要


列挙型定数説明
CPU_LIMITATION_LEVEL_1制限低
CPU_LIMITATION_LEVEL_2 
CPU_LIMITATION_LEVEL_3制限中
CPU_LIMITATION_LEVEL_4 
CPU_LIMITATION_LEVEL_5制限高
CPU_LIMITATION_LEVEL_DEFAULT初期値
CPU_LIMITATION_LEVEL_UNDEFINED未定義
制限レベルについて

Level5の状態が長時間継続した場合、グラスの画面カクツキなどの表示不正が起こりやすくなります。

メソッドの概要


修飾子とタイプメソッド説明
static CpuLimitationLevelStatusfromLevel(int level)CPU制限レベルから対応する状態を返却
int`getLevel()CPU制限レベルを取得
static CpuLimitationLevelStatusvalueOf(String name)指定された名前のこのクラスの列挙定数を返す
static CpuLimitationLevelStatus[]values()この列挙型クラスの定数を、宣言された順序で含む配列を返す

列挙型定数の詳細


CPU_LIMITATION_LEVEL_UNDEFINED
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_UNDEFINED
未定義
CPU_LIMITATION_LEVEL_DEFAULT
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_DEFAULT
初期値
CPU_LIMITATION_LEVEL_1
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_1
制限低
CPU_LIMITATION_LEVEL_2
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_2
CPU_LIMITATION_LEVEL_3
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_3
制限中
CPU_LIMITATION_LEVEL_4
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_4
CPU_LIMITATION_LEVEL_5
public static final CpuLimitationLevelStatus CPU_LIMITATION_LEVEL_5
制限高
制限レベルについて

Level5の状態が長時間継続した場合、グラスの画面カクツキなどの表示不正が起こりやすくなります。


メソッドの詳細


values

public static CpuLimitationLevelStatus[] values()
この列挙型クラスの定数を、宣言された順序で含む配列を返す

戻り値:
この列挙型クラスの定数を宣言された順序で含む配列

valueOf

public static CpuLimitationLevelStatus valueOf(String name)
指定された名前のこのクラスの列挙定数を返す。文字列は、このクラスで列挙定数を宣言するために使用された識別子と正確に一致しなければならない。
(余分な空白文字は許可されない。)

パラメータ:
name - 返される列挙型定数の名前
戻り値:
指定した名前の列挙型定数
例外:
IllegalArgumentException - この列挙型クラスに指定された名前の定数が存在しない場合
NullPointerException - 引数がnullの場合

getLevel

public int getLevel()
CPU制限レベルを取得

戻り値:
CPU制限レベル

fromLevel

public static CpuLimitationLevelStatus fromLevel(int level)
CPU制限レベルから対応する状態を返却

パラメータ:
level - CPU制限レベル
戻り値:
対応する状態
例外:
IllegalArgumentException - 不明なCPU制限レベルの場合